Simplify:Rewrite in the expression (9^7)(9^5) in the form of 9^n

Answer:

The answer is 9¹² .

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that the Indices Law is :

[tex] {a}^{m} \times {a}^{n} = {a}^{m + n} [/tex]

So for this question :

[tex] {9}^{7} \times {9}^{5} [/tex]

[tex] = {9}^{(7 + 5)} [/tex]

[tex] = {9}^{12} [/tex]
